In the r/SexToys subreddit about the quietest/easiest to use male sex toys, users point out that harder silicone is easier to clean because it’s less tacky, but assure that there are a few tricks for washing your bedside bae. Given that the interior of most peen machines will be made out of a porous, body-safe silicone that’s firm but soft to the touch, many users suggest cleaning them with mild soap and water and dusting on cornstarch afterwards. “I simply use my fingers to vigorously work out all of the debris/fluid from the inside… while water runs into the sleeve from the bathtub faucet,” a user writes, “This method has never failed. I haven't lost a sleeve. And I wouldn't be afraid to eat off of any of my sleeves if I was forced to.” Boner appétit.

Many male-focused sexual wellness brands also make devices dedicated to keeping male masturbators in tip-top shape with life-extending (for the toy, not us; RIP) powders that can be applied to strokers once they’ve been thoroughly rinsed, cleaned, and dried—like, bone dry—to keep the silicone sparkling, soft, and fresh.
